OKLAHOMA CITY – The Women’s Premier Soccer League, the largest women’s soccer league in the world, has announced the 2018 All-Conference teams for the West Region.
WPSL Champion Seattle Sounders Women lead all West Region clubs with seven players on the Northwest All-Conference team. Seven West Region clubs are tied for second with four players on their respective all-conference teams, including Canadian expansion club TSS Rovers and Pac North champion Fresno FC Ladies
The players on the West Region All-Conference teams attend or have graduated from colleges across 22 states and two Canadian provinces. The Pac-12 Conference has nine of its 12 universities represented on the West Region All-Conference teams.
Clubs within each of the four conferences nominated players to determine their respective All-Conference team. The all-conference teams for the remaining three regions will be revealed throughout the week. For more information, visit wpslsoccer.com.
The WPSL is in its 22nd season and is the largest women’s soccer league in the world with more than 100 clubs from coast-to-coast. WPSL rosters feature elite collegiate, post-collegiate, international and standout prep student-athletes. Many of the United States’ most accomplished women’s players have played in the WPSL, including household names such as Alex Morgan, Abby Wambach, Megan Rapinoe, Julie Foudy and Brandi Chastain.
